Social And Cultural Activities
|
Since college days, actively participated in various cultural activities, such as theatre,
debate and other co-curricular activities; organised blood donation camps, rehabilitation
programmes and rendered all kinds of support to the socially and economically deprived women
through “Ganatantrik Mahila Samiti”
|
Special Interests
|
Took special interest in fighting the atrocities committed against the economically and socially
backward women
|
Favourite Pastime and Recreation
|
Reading books, especially on economics, social affairs, novels and plays by eminent authors; and gardening
